Last week's episode of the Game Informer Show podcast was the great Matt Helgeson's last time hosting the show. This week marks a new era for The Game Informer Show. The podcast is now co-hosted by Ben Hanson and Tim Turi and will cover more games than ever, a weekly reader/listener feedback section, and a rotating final segment that should pack in plenty of surprises. As you can see below, the biggest change is that The Game Informer Show is now also a video podcast! You can still download and listen to the audio version, but video allows us to show off some gameplay and let you see our dumb faces. Also, despite the timing of this post, we are still planning on releasing new episodes every Thursday at 7pm Central.
